Seattle Counseling Service specializes in helping Seattle's local LGBT community across a variety of needs, including coming out, depression, anxiety, gender transitioning, grief or loss, domestic violence, and aging. The Service also helps with substance addictions and provides LGBT cultural competency trainings to other organizations, schools, universities, and businesses.
